For those of a more traditional bent, there's Savile Row transplant Leonard Logsdail, who works in a style some call "Brit limited" (a little shape in the waist, just a bit of shoulder padding). Mostly created from a "nine-month weight" of wool, his suits run about $4,000-$5,000. With two pairs of trousers at around $1,000 each, and a couple of handmade shirts thrown in, you're looking at a nice year-end bonus right there. If you're determined to have real-deal Savile Row and nothing but, Anderson & Sheppard (32 Old Burlington Street, London W1S 3AT) has been suiting Prince Charles for many years, and has been one of London's leading tailors since 1906; it sends representatives to the U.S. every spring and autumn to take measurements and a 50% deposit (for itinerary, log on to Anderson-Sheppard). Benson & Clegg was the tailor to George VI, the Queen's grandfather. H. Huntsman is supposed to make the most pricey suits on Savile Row, while the "new bespoke" (i.e. younger) movement is being championed by tailors such as Timothy Everest, who studied under the legendary 60s suit-maker Tommy Nutter, and designer/reality TV star Ozwald Boteng. Whichever you choose, once you go bespoke, it'll be tough to go back to anything else.
